A Device to Cyclic Lateral Loaded Model Piles

CODEN: GTJODJ

Abstract

Model tests on small scale piles subject to cyclic lateral loading have been carried out with the purpose of simulating the pile soil behavior and its lateral resistance under environmental loads. An efficient mechanical loading system has been developed. This system is able to provide both one-way and two-way cyclic lateral loads. Frequencies and load levels in both directions can be varied in order to simulate different load conditions. There is no limitation on the number of cycles. A series of lateral cyclic loading tests for a monopile in dry sand have been carried out to demonstrate the efficiency and effectiveness of this loading system. The benefits of this innovative loading system are presented.
